titleOfInvention |
Flame retardant resin composition |
abstract |
A flame retardant resin composition comprises a silicone resin havingnspecific structure and weight-average molecular weight and a non-siliconenresin having aromatic-ring. The silicone resin has R 2 SiO 1.0 units andnRSiO 1.5 units. The weight-average molecular weight of the silicone resin isnin the range of not less than 10,000 to not more than 270,000. R isnhydrocarbon group, preferably a combination of methyl and phenyl groups. n The non-silicone base resin is preferably polycarbonate, polycarbonate/ABS ornpolystyrene. |
